Тема: Работа с командной строкой операционной системы
Продолжительность 4 часа
Вопросы (задачи), подлежащие исследованию.
1.1. Файловая система MS DOC . Логические диски, каталоги, файлы. Текущий каталог. Имена файлов. Полные имена. Атрибуты.
1.2. Командная строка MS DOC. Правила диалога. Команды и параметры.
1.3. Команды ATTRIB, COPY, DEL, DIR, FC, MKDIR, MORE, RENAME, RMDIR, SORT, TYPE, TREE.
1.4. Стандартные устройства. Операции перенаправления и конвейеризации.
1.5. Групповые операции. Шаблоны в именах файлов.
Краткие теоретические или справочно-информационные материалы.
2.1. attrib - установка атрибутов файла (г, s, h, а).
2.2. chdir (cd) - перейти по дереву каталогов вверх (..) или вниз (указав имя подкаталога).
2.3. del [путь][имя файла] /р - удаляет один или более файлов с запросом подтверждения на удаление.
2.4. dir - выводит список каталогов и файлов, которые содержатся в выбранном Вами каталоге.
2.5. find /n "строка" [путь][имя файла] - ищет в файле и выводит строку (текст),укачанную в кавычках, и ее помер.
2.6. mkdir (md) [disk:][nyTb к новому каталогу]- создает новые каталоги.
2.7. rename (ren) [путь][старое имя файла] повое имя - переименовывает файл.
2.8. tree [путь к каталогу] - изображает структуру каталога (его подкаталоги).
2.9. undelete [имя файла] - восстанавливает файлы, удаленные командой del.
2.10. сору [путь и имя (что и откуда)][путь и имя (куда и с каким именем)] - копирует файлы в указанное место.
Примеры использования команды сору:
сору c:\user\myfilel.txt c:\user\new\newfile.txt - перенос файла в другой каталог с изменением имени.
сору c:\uscr\filel .txt+filc2txt ncwfilc.txt - присоединяет второй файл к первому и дает файлу новое имя.
сору c:\config.sys ргл - выводит текст файла config.sys на принтер.
2.11. cls - очистка экрана.
2.12. date - показывает или устанавливает текущую дату.
2.13. edit - запускает редактор MS DOS<
2.14. exit - выход из прикладной программы в DOS.
2.15. help - вызывает программу-справочник по командам MS DOS.
2.16. mem - показывает распределение памяти между загруженными программами и
количество свободной памяти.
2.17. print [путь] имя файла - печатает текст файла в фоновом режиме.s. sys [диск1:] диск2: - копирует системные файлы iO.SYS, MSDOS.SYS и command.com с дика!: на диск2;, создавая тем самым системный диск.
2.18. time - показывает или устанавливает текущее время..
2.19. type [путь] имя текстового файла - выводит на экран текст файла.
3. Рекомендации студентам по подготовке к лабораторной работе с указанием литературы.
При подготовке к выполнению лабораторной работы необходимо изучить следующие вопросы:
3.1. Клавиатура. Алфавитно-цифровые клавиши, Регистровые клавиши. Клавиши управления курсором. Специальные клавиши Enter, Esc, BackSpace, Space, Delete, CapsLock, /, \, |. Функциональные клавиши.
3.2. Файловая система MS-DOS. Логические диски, каталоги, файлы. Текущий каталог. Имена файлов. Полные имена. Атрибуты.
3.3. Источники
3.3.1. Иванов М.И, Уткин Ю.Г. . Информатика. Учебное пособие М.: Изд-во «Альтаир» МГАВТ, 2004.
Описание лабораторного оборудования.
4.1. . Персональный компьютер – ПЭВМ.
4.2. .Программное обеспечение: OC WindowsXP (9х – любой версии)
5. Краткое содержание работы, выполняемой студентами в ходе занятия.
5.1. Создать на диске D: каталог
5.2. С помощью команды SORT получить в файле name.txt список, упорядоченный по фамилиям.
5.3. С помощью команды TYPE вывести name.txt на экран.
5.4. С помощью команды ATTRIB установить для файлов с расширением txt атрибут “скрытый” (hidden).
5.5. С помощью команды DIR вывести список файлов каталога D:\WORK и всех его подкаталогов в файл с именем dir.
5.6. Переименовать все файлы в рабочем каталоге так, чтобы вместо расширения txt у них появилось расширение doc.
5.7. Скопировать все файлы из рабочей директории в каталог D:\TMP1.
5.8. Сравнить содержимое файлов dir.w и dir.tmp, находящихся в рабочем каталоге.
5.9. Объединить все файлы с расширениями txt в каталоге D:\TMP1 в один файл с именем sum.txt, а все файлы с расширением doc в файл sum.doc.
Порядок проведения работы.
6.1. Войдите в режим эмуляции MS DOC командой: Пуск, Программы, Стандартные, Режим MS DOC.
6.2. Перейти на диск С командой: CD\
6.3. На диске С: создать подкаталог с именем группы командой: С:> md _SME36.
6.4. Перейдите в каталог SME36 командой C:> cd _SME36
6.5. Создайте подкаталог с фамилией SEMENOV командой: С:/ SME36/ SEMENOV. (по аналогии с п.3)
6.6. В созданном подкаталоге создать текстовый файл командой: COPY _CON_ TEST.txt
Артемьев 1979 185 78
Петров 1980 183 79
Васильев 1978 190 93
Яшин 1979 181 75
Сидоров 1981 191 92
Кузнецов 1980 182 82
1 пробел 12пр 19пр 24пробел
По окончании ввода нажать клавишу F6
6.7. Просмотрите созданный текстовый файл командой: TYPE _TEST.txt
6.8. Получите файл name.txt, упорядоченный по фамилиям с использованием команды SORT_/+1_<test.txt>name.txt, где +1 номер позиции в строке.
6.9. Просмотрите созданный файл. (по аналогии с п.7)
6.10. Получите файлы age.txt, long.txt упорядоченные по дате рождения и росту.(по аналогии с п.8)
6.11. Переименуйте файлы так, чтобы вместо расширения . txt у них появилось .doc. командой: REN _ *.txt _ *.doc
6.12. Установите, атрибут «скрытый» для файлов age.txt, long.txt командой: АTTRIB _+ H _ age.doc
6.13. Перейдите в каталог SME36 командой :CD_..
6.14. Выведите на экран список файлов каталога SEMENOV командой DIR_SEMENOV/S/P , где S- информация о каталоге и файлах,
6.15. Создайте в катологе SME36 два подкаталога TMP , SM. .(по аналогии с п.3)
6.16. Скопируйте файл TEST.txt в подкаталог SM командой COPY : COPY C:\SME36\SEMENOV \TEST.doc _C:\SME36\SM
6.17. Скопируйте все файлы из каталога SEMENOV в подкаталог TMP
6.18. Создайте в каталоге SM файл famil.txt с содержанием данных о себе
6.19. Объедините все файлы в подкаталоге SM в один файл, командой COPY_ TEST.doc+famil.txt _SUM.txt
6.20. Выведите дерево каталога SME36 командой : TREE_SME36/F
6.21. Закройте окно “режим MSDOS”. Скопируйте папку SME36 в свою рабочую папку в «Мои документы» используя инструменты копирования WINDOWS.
Техника безопасности.
При выполнении лабораторной работы необходимо строго соблюдать меры безопасности, для чего:
7.1. Включать электропитание ПК только по команде преподавателя (с разрешения преподавателя);
7.2. Строго соблюдать последовательность включения и выключения ПК; ИБП .
7.3. Категорически запрещается :
7.3.1. производить вскрытие системных блоков;
7.3.2. отключение и подключение интерфейсных кабелей и кабелей питания как во время работы, так и при отключенном напряжении;
7.3.3. производить несанкционированные действия с элементами системы ввода (мышь, клавиатура);
7.3.4. Делать перестановки оборудования на рабочем месте
Исходные данные для работы.
8.1. Операционная система MS Windows, MS DOS/
8.2. конспект лекций;
8.3. указания преподавателя по подготовке и проведению лабораторной работе.
9. Методика анализа полученных результатов. Контрольные вопросы.
9.1. Полученные в ходе работы файлы и папки должны иметь образец оформления и содержания, представленный в папке Мои документы\образ\лаб3
9.2. Можно ли, находясь на диске C:, вывести каталог диска D: в файл, находящийся на диске E: ?
9.3. Требуется создать файл с полным именем D:\WORK\36\PETROV\TEST.TXT. На диске D: нет ни одного каталога, но есть файл с именем work. Варианты Ваших действий?
9.4. Вы хотите скопировать содержимое двух дискет A: на диск D: в каталог A. При этом неплохо бы на всякий случай запротоколировать процедуру копирования. Как это организовать?
9.5. Будет ли выполняться команда REN D:\*\*.txt *.doc? Если да, то как она сработает? Если нет, то почему?
9.6. Чем отличаются указанные множества файлов: *.???, *.*, *.?*, ?*.*, *.?*?, *a.* ?
9.7. К чему приведет выполнение команды COPY *.* 1 ? А команды COPY *.* * ?
9.8. Как вывести на экран список всех файлов и подкаталогов данного каталога?
9.9. Как прочитать содержимое длинного текстового файла?
9.10. Как узнать, какие файлы хранятся на диске и в каких директориях?
9.11. Чем отличается информация, выводимая командами DIR /S и TREE /F и ATTRIB /S?
9.12. Как сделать текущим диск D: ?
9.13. Как определить, совпадает ли содержимое двух файлов?
9.14. Как создать каталог и как его удалить?
9.15. Когда нужна команда MORE и как ею пользоваться?
9.16. Что делает компьютер по команде SORT и откуда он берет исходную информацию?
10. Порядок оформления отчета по лабораторной работе и его защиты.
10.1. Название работы, дата выполнения, исполнитель.
10.2. Цель работы.
10.3. Исходные данные.
10.4. Перечень применяемых приборов и материалов.
10.5. . Ход и результаты работы.
10.6. Ответы на контрольные вопросы.
10.7. Прохождение теста по командам DOS.
10.8. Выводы.
ЛАБОРАТОРНАЯ РАБОТА № 4